I've looked into it again, and nowadays it uses 'Ubuntu 22.04'[1] for
that, so we can simply use the latest Trisquel version instead
(Trisquel 11.0 LTS).

Alternatively we could submit patches to not require another
distribution to build the module and/or to use Guix for building it.

If I recall well it is done in this way to increase compatibility with
distributions as older modules probably work better in recent kernels
than the opposite.
